Title: Innovations in Imaging Technology: The Patents of Mitsuo Niida

Introduction: Mitsuo Niida, a prominent inventor based in Tokyo, Japan, has made significant contributions to the field of imaging technology. With an impressive portfolio of 38 patents, Niida continues to push the boundaries of innovation through his work at Canon Kabushiki Kaisha.

Latest Patents: Niida's recent patents showcase advancements in imaging apparatuses and client devices. Among his latest inventions are an imaging apparatus that integrates a control unit to manage the insertion and retraction of an infrared cut filter, and a method that enhances the functionality of image superimposing techniques in image pickup systems. These inventions highlight a focus on automated control systems and user-friendly device management.
